#ba5400 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#ba5400 is composed of 72.9% red, 32.9%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 54.8% magenta, 100% yellow and 27.1% black. It has a hue angle of 27.1 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 36.5%. #ba5400 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ffa800 with #750000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6600.

#ba5400 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#ba5400 has RGB values of R:186, G:84,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.55, Y:1, K:0.27. Its decimal value is 12211200.
